Noun [Italian]

Forms: ceti medi [plural]
Etymology: Literally, “middle class”. Etymology templates: {{m-g|middle class}} “middle class”, {{lit|middle class}} Literally, “middle class” Head templates: {{it-noun|m}} ceto medio m (plural ceti medi)
  1. middle class Tags: masculine Categories (topical): Collectives, Sociology
